Sulfur is an essential macronutrient in the agricultural sector, playing a pivotal role in the growth and development of plants. One of its key chemical properties is its ability to form compounds, such as sulfate, which are readily absorbed by plants. Sulfur is integral to the synthesis of amino acids, proteins, and enzymes, contributing to overall plant health and productivity. Its role in chlorophyll production further emphasizes its importance, as it aids in photosynthesis, the process through which plants convert light energy into chemical energy.
In addition to these vital functions, sulfur's antimicrobial properties make it an effective component in agricultural practices. It helps in controlling various plant diseases and pests, thereby reducing the reliance on chemical pesticides and promoting sustainable farming methods. Innovative sulfur-based agricultural products are increasingly recognized for their essential role in enhancing agricultural productivity and sustainability. Sulfur is a vital nutrient for plant growth, influencing enzyme functions, photosynthesis, and overall plant health. According to a report by Grand View Research, the global sulfur market for agricultural use was valued at approximately $4.5 billion in 2022, and it is projected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.1% from 2023 to 2030. This growth is driven by the rising global demand for food and the need for sustainable farming practices.
A notable innovation in sulfur-based products is the development of sulfur-coated fertilizers, which provide a slow-release mechanism for sulfur, improving its availability to plants over time. This not only enhances nutrient efficiency but also minimizes nutrient leaching and environmental impact. Research from the International Fertilizer Association indicates that sulfur deficiency affects about 60% of the world's soils, highlighting the need for effective sulfur management in agriculture. These innovative products not only help in addressing nutrient deficiencies but also support the growing demand for environmentally friendly agricultural solutions, thereby contributing significantly to the industry's growth and resilience.
